Some versions come pre-loaded with custom ball skins, colors, and trail effects that usually require hours of grinding to unlock. Why Do Players Look for Slope 3 Unblocked?

A major driver for the popularity of "hacked" versions is their availability as "unblocked" games. Students and employees often use these mirrors to bypass filters on restricted Wi-Fi networks. Sites like Coolmath Games or specialized Slope Rider portals provide access when official app stores or gaming sites are restricted. As one of the most popular endless runners on the web, the game series has captivated millions with its simple yet thrilling premise: guide a neon ball down a seemingly infinite, high-speed track at breakneck velocity. The core gameplay is deceptively straightforward. Using just the left and right arrow keys or A/D controls, players must navigate a winding, three-dimensional slope filled with sharp turns, narrow pathways, red obstacles, and dreaded gaps that lead to a game-over fall into the void below.
